当前位置:首页 > 业务领域 > 污泥处理
一文读懂Python的数字类型【亚博网页界面登陆】
时间:2021-08-08 来源:亚博网站登陆 浏览量 59696 次
本文摘要:数据类型数据类型是不可以逆类型。

数据类型数据类型是不可以逆类型。说白了的不可以逆类型,所说的是类型的值一旦有有所不同了,那麼它便是一个全新升级的对象。数字1和2分别意味着2个有所不同的对象,对变量新的取值一个数据类型,不容易新创建一个数据对象。

亚博网站登陆

還是要着重强调一下Python的变量和数据信息类型的关联,变量仅仅对某一对象的提及也就是说编号、姓名、启用这些,变量自身没数据信息类型的定义。只有1,[1,2],"hello"这一类对象才具有数据信息类型的定义。Python抵制三种有所不同的数据类型,整数、浮点数和复数。

整数一般来说称之为整形,标值为因此以或是胜,不携带小数位。python3的整形能够作为Long类型用以,因此 python3没python2的Long类型。

答复数据的情况下,有时候大家还不容易用八进制或十六进制来答复:十六进制用0x后缀名和0-9,a-f答复,比如:0xff00八进制用0o后缀名和0-7答复,比如0o45python的整数长短为16,32位系统,而且一般来说是到数分配内存室内空间的。从上边的室内空间详细地址看,详细地址中间恰好差16,32。小整数对象池python复位的情况下不容易全自动建立一个小整数对象池,便捷大家启用,避免 中后期不断溶解!这是一个包含262个偏向整数对象的指针数组,范畴是-5到256。换句话说例如整数10,即便 我们在程序流程里没创立它,只不过是在Python后台管理早就悄悄的为大家创立了。

为何要那样呢?大家都告知,在程序执行时,还包含Python后台管理自身的经营自然环境中,不容易频烦用以这一范畴内的整数,假如每务必一个,你也就创立一个,那麼不容置疑不容易降低许多 开支。创立一个依然不会有,承诺保存,随时使用随拿的小整数对象池,不容置疑是个比较性价比高的做法。

从id(-6)和id(257)的详细地址,大家能显出小整数对象池的范畴,恰好是-5到256。除开小整数对象池,Python也有整数缓冲区域的定义,也就是不久被清除的整数,会被的确立刻清除多次重复使用,只是在后台管理油压缓冲器一段时间,等待下一次的有可能启用。上边,我给变量a取值了整数100,看过一下它的内存地址。随后我将a删掉,又创立个新的变量b,依然取值为100,再一次看看b的内存地址,和之前a不会有的是一样的。

浮点数浮点数也就是小数,如1.23,3.14,-9.01,这些。


本文关键词:亚博网站登陆,亚博网页界面登陆

本文来源:亚博网站登陆-www.smsbuys.com

版权所有温州市网页界面登陆科技有限公司 浙ICP备93095540号-8

公司地址: 浙江省温州市务川仡佬族苗族自治县远计大楼570号 联系电话:098-54571326

Copyright © 2018 Corporation,All Rights Reserved.

熊猫生活志熊猫生活志微信公众号
成都鑫华成都鑫华微信公众号